#72986f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#72986f is composed of 44.7% red, 59.6% green and 43.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25% cyan, 0% magenta, 27%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 115.6 degrees, a saturation of 16.6% and a lightness of 51.6%. #72986f color hex could be obtained by blending #e4ffde with #003100.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#72986f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030503 is the darkest color, while #f8faf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#72986f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#828582 is the less saturated color, while #21f710 is the most saturated one.
